The display uses LED-backlit LCD technology with a VA panel, spanning a 49″ screen size at a 5120 x 1440 pixel resolution and a pixel density of 108 ppi. It operates at a 144Hz refresh rate with a 1ms response time, and supports AMD FreeSync Premium Pro adaptive synchronization for smoother rendering. Both horizontal and vertical viewing angles reach 178 degrees, offering a wide usable range from various positions. The panel is glossy rather than matte and does not feature an anti-glare coating, nor does it support touch input.
This is a gaming, curved, ultrawide monitor with physical dimensions of 1147 mm wide, 363 mm tall, and 293 mm deep, weighing 15,600 g. The stand supports both tilt and swivel adjustments, and the unit is compatible with VESA mounting, though portrait mode is not supported. It carries an EU energy label of G. Operating temperatures range from 10 °C to 40 °C, and the total volume is approximately 121,993 cm³.
The display offers a typical brightness of 350 nits alongside a contrast ratio of 2500:1, allowing for a reasonable distinction between light and dark areas of the image. It is capable of rendering 1,070 million colors, and the monitor supports color calibration, giving users the ability to adjust and fine-tune color output to their needs.
The monitor provides two HDMI 2.1 ports and one DisplayPort 1.4 output for video input, with no mini DisplayPort, DVI, or VGA connectors present. Three USB ports are available, though there is no USB Type-C and no Thunderbolt support. A 3.5mm audio jack is included for headset connectivity. Wireless options are absent entirely, with no Wi-Fi, Ethernet, or AirPlay support on this model.
During normal use, the monitor draws 45W of power, while in standby mode that figure drops significantly to just 0.5W.
The monitor includes Picture-in-Picture (PiP) support, allowing multiple sources to be displayed simultaneously. Beyond that, the feature set is limited — there are no stereo speakers, no built-in smart TV functionality, and no remote control included. Audio formats such as Dolby Digital, Dolby Digital Plus, and DTS Surround are not supported. The unit also lacks an ambient light sensor and a front-facing camera.
